I would like to know if it is possible to launch more than one node connected to Rinkeby from the same machine through Geth and Mist.

In a local testnet, it is possible to do it changing the --port and --rpcport, but I am trying the same connecting to Rinkeby and I get the following error:

    Database closed                 
    Fatal: Error starting protocol stack: Access is denied.

I can launch another geth instance just if I disable the ipc-rpc (--icpdisable), but it is not the right solution since it is not possible to deploy Mist.

You could try using docker. There are lots of network configuration options with docker (it is can be a bit confusing often getting all this right actually).

Try run the following two commands. They bind the ethereum nodes to different ports.

docker run --name ethereum-one \
           -p 8545:8545 -p 30303:30303 \
           ethereum/client-go --rinkeby



docker run --name ethereum-two \
           -p 8546:8545 -p 30304:30303 \
           ethereum/client-go --rinkeby

https://hub.docker.com/r/ethereum/client-go/ <- is the reference. I'm sorry I can't give more details, but I know it is possible with docker. Good luck.
